WebMar 31, 2024 · In order to constrain memory and enable smooth scrolling, content is rendered asynchronously offscreen. This means it's possible to scroll faster than the fill rate and momentarily see blank content. This is a tradeoff that can be adjusted to suit the needs of each application, and we are working on improving it behind the scenes. WebAug 6, 2024 · React Native’s ScrollView component is a generic container that can contain multiple elements — Views, Texts, Pressables, and even another ScrollView. After putting all those elements inside the ScrollView component, you can use it to scroll through them vertically (the default) or horizontally (by adding it as a prop).

If you wish to simply get the current position (e.g. when some button is pressed) rather than tracking it whenever the user scrolls, then invoking an onScroll listener is going to cause performance issues. Currently the most performant way to simply get current scroll position is using react-native-invoke package.
